TL;DR
Associate Mechanical Engineer (Manufacturing/CAD): Designing, prototyping, testing, and documenting mechanical components, systems, and equipment from concept through manufacturing release with an accent on CAD, high-volume manufacturing, and product validation. Focus on applying FEA and FMEA, creating prototypes and testing plans, improving existing designs, and preparing drawings, bills of materials, and engineering change documentation.

Location: Hybrid in Melville, New York, United States; up to 10% domestic and international travel required.

Salary: $70,000–$80,000 per year, dependent on skills, experience, qualifications, and geographic location.

Company

hirify.global develops electrical, lighting, data networking, and energy management solutions, with more than 115 years of history.

What you will do

  • Design, analyze, prototype, and develop mechanical components, systems, and equipment from concept through manufacturing release.
  • Use CAD and computer-assisted engineering software to create designs, drawings, and technical documentation.
  • Create functional prototypes and develop testing and validation methods for products and systems.
  • Prepare product documentation packages, including 2-D drawings, bills of materials, and engineering change orders.
  • Analyze existing products and designs to identify improvements, troubleshoot issues, and research mechanical engineering problems.
  • Collect, analyze, and summarize product data, trends, test results, and validation findings.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in Mechanical Engineering.
  • Basic knowledge of mechanical design, high-volume production parts and assemblies, and manufacturing processes.
  • Ability to understand and apply FEA and FMEA in product design and development.
  • Experience with 3D CAD and drafting; SolidWorks is preferred.
  • Experience reading electrical and mechanical drawings, with basic familiarity with PC boards, electronics packaging, regulatory compliance, and validation testing.
  • Ability to solve problems creatively and work both independently and in a team environment; working knowledge of Microsoft Office.

Nice to have

  • Prior internship or co-op experience.
  • SolidWorks experience.

Culture & Benefits

  • Hybrid work environment with a collaborative engineering team.
  • Medical, dental, and vision insurance.
  • 401(k) plan with employer matching contributions.
  • Tuition reimbursement, paid time off, paid holidays, and volunteer time off.
